Maria J. Baker is a scholar working on Genetics, Pathology and Forensic Medicine and Oncology. According to data from OpenAlex, Maria J. Baker has authored 19 papers receiving a total of 476 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Genetics, 8 papers in Pathology and Forensic Medicine and 5 papers in Oncology. Recurrent topics in Maria J. Baker's work include Genetic factors in colorectal cancer (8 papers), BRCA gene mutations in cancer (7 papers) and Colorectal Cancer Screening and Detection (3 papers). Maria J. Baker is often cited by papers focused on Genetic factors in colorectal cancer (8 papers), BRCA gene mutations in cancer (7 papers) and Colorectal Cancer Screening and Detection (3 papers). Maria J. Baker collaborates with scholars based in United States, Australia and India. Maria J. Baker's co-authors include Thomas J. McGarrity, Ian Schreibman, Christopher I. Amos, Brian Saunders, Andrea Manni, Eugene J. Lengerich, Brenda C. Kluhsman, Gregory Harper, Laura Conway and James R. Broach and has published in prestigious journals such as Cancer Research, The American Journal of Gastroenterology and Human Pathology.
